Latest Patents
One of her latest patents is a method and apparatus for generating an audio notification file for a computing device. This invention involves selecting a first audio file associated with a first mental state as the initial section of the audio notification file. The audio notification file is designed for storage in memory and is capable of being processed by a processing unit to control a speaker. The final state of the audio notification file is determined and designated as the final section, which is associated with a second mental state. Additionally, at least one intermediate section is generated by morphing the first audio file to the final state using a digital signal processor.
